- The distance between Managua, Nicaragua and Macon, Georgia, Usa is approximately 2,300 km or 1,429 mi.
- To reach Managua in this distance one would set out from Macon, Georgia bearing 187.4°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Managua bearing 186.4° or S .
- Managua has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Macon, Georgia has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Managua is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Macon, Georgia is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 8.8 °C (15.8°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.9 °C (32.2°F) less in Managua.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 8.4 mm (0.3 in) more which is equivalent to 8.4 l/m² (0.21 US gal/ft²) or 84,000 l/ha (8,980 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 15.6° higher in Managua than in Macon, Georgia.
